Eve Johnson Houghton 10 Two-year-olds to Follow in 2020


Woodway Stables, Blewbury, Oxfordshire is steeped in racing history. Eve returned to Wooday in 1999 to followed in the footsteps of her father Fulke who trained at this beautiful location for over forty years. However, the story doesn't stop there because his mother, Helen, preceded him as did her husband, Gordon.  

Eve has trained a number of exceptional horses. Who could forget Tout Seul in the ownership of Eden Racing, very much a bargain buy at 12,000, but a wonderful specimen? He ran seven times at two winning five races. This son of Ali-Royal went on to win the Darley Dewhurst Stakes (Group 1). 

He went on to finish 4th in the 2000 Guineas (losing by just over a length) and campaigned at the highest level at three including racing far afield as Lonchamp, France, Kyoto & Tokyo, Japan. 

Tout Seul went on to stand at stud. 

Accidental Agent was another very talented horse who won the Queen Anne Stakes (Group 1) at Royal Ascot. 

Personally, two-year-old horses I remember include Roodle (2009), Zingana (2011) won on debut at odds of 100/1, Alutiq (2013), Cool Bahamian (2013), Room Key (2014),  Bahamadam (2016), Tin Hat (2018), Oberyn Martell (2018) & Graceful Magic (2019).

Eve has kindly forwarded 10 two-year-olds to follow this Flat season 2020. We thank her kindly for taking the time and wish the stable all the best for this season. Reviewing the Horses in Training publication Eve has 28 juveniles in training at this time.         

BATINDI 

Filly 
Bated Breath (GB)

Rohlind (GB) 

18,000 Guineas purchase for owner Mrs. C. Vigors and a full-sister to Mistress Of Venice

“A well-made filly who just started to grow as the lockdown came in, so has gone back home for some Dr Green (grass). Where she is reportedly doing well. Will come back in, in June with an eye to running early August.”

BHUBEZI 

Colt 
Starspangledbanner (AUS)

Lulani (IRE) 

£40,000 purchase at the Premier Yearling Sales for owners Mr & Mrs. James Blyth Currie 

“A good moving son of Starspangledbanner who does everything easily. I would imagine him being out late June time.” 

DARK ILLUSION 

Colt 
Equiano (FR) 

Magic Escapade (IRE) 

Owned by the Kimber Family and a half-brother to Graceful Magic.

“Very pleased with this boy, who moves well and impressed in his early work. Should be out the end of June.” 

DARK SHIFT 

Colt 
Dark Angel (IRE) 

Mosuo (IRE) 

50,000 Guineas purchase for owner H Frost 

“A first foal, who looked a bit weak when we bought him. He has grown & strengthened really well. He continues to thrive & would be one for the back end.” 

ENDURING

Colt
Coulsty (IRE) 

Yearbook (GB) 

Purchased for 10,000 and owned by Marc Middleton Heath

“He was Lot 1 at the Ascot Yearling Sales, so the first yearling I bought last year. He has shown up well on the gallops and will be one of the earliest out. He has grown a huge amount and looks like a lovely horse now.” 

JUMBY 

Colt 
New Bay (GB) 

Sound Of Guns (GB) 

45,000 Guineas purchase for owners Anthony Pye-Jeary & David Ian

“A gorgeous horse who takes the eye every time you see him. Moves well and looks the part. Will be one for later on.”

ROOFUL 

Filly 
Charming Thought (GB)

Roodle (GB) 

10,000 Guineas purchase for owner Mrs. R. F. Johnson Houghton and a half-sister to Accidental Agent 

“A bit backward at the moment and is going to be a big filly in the end. Will not be seen on the racecourse until late September at the earliest.” 

SCHILTHORN 

Gelding
Swiss Spirit (GB) 

Wall of Sound (GB) 

Owned by The Mighty Mouse Partnership and a half-brother to the promising 102 rated Tom Dascombe filly Boomer.

“Easy moving, but a bit heavy topped so we took this downtime as an opportunity to geld him. He is strong and goes well, should be running mid-season.” 

SOLDIER LIONS 

Colt 

Equiano (FR) 

Stylos Ecossais (GB) 

£30,000 purchase and owned by H.H Shaikh Nasser Al Khalifa & Partner 

“A lovely horse who works very well, I would anticipate him being one of the earliest on the track and can see a bright future for him.” 

TIPSY LAIRD

Colt 

Gleneagles (IRE) 

Lady Eclair (IRE) 

82,000 Guineas purchase and owned by Mr & Mrs. Nicholas Johnston.

“A big, gorgeous horse who we sent to Hen Knight's for a while to get him doing plenty of groundwork to strengthen him up. He has done really well there and will be coming back in shortly. He will probably have one run back end. A middle-distance type.”
